We believe that all children should have a nurturing environment which promotes a successful early learning experience. K.Z.V. Armenian Preschool is committed to fostering continued growth and development of the “whole child”, which encompasses the areas of social, emotional, cognitive, creative and physical skills. Krouzian-Zekarian-Vasbouragan Armenian Preschool emphasizes the values of our Armenian culture and heritage through ethnic songs, folkloric dances, prayers and storytelling. Individual differences as well as other cultural values are recognized and appreciated.
K.Z.V. Armenian Preschool’s curriculum is based on active play and Developmentally Appropriate Practices (D.A.P.) with a thematic focus. The daily schedule consists of a good balance of child initiated and teacher directed educational activities. We offer a playful learning environment, which emphasizes the following five developmental learning domains:
Teachers and teacher assistants are bilingual, experienced and have exceeded the Early Childhood Education State requirements. They are trained in pediatric CPR and First Aid.
